Transaction 89f7a1ed3470b56e67820965693034cc54ff5d58c0617ad372a964d91aea26d0
1 Input
1 Output
-
89f7a1ed3470b56e67820965693034cc54ff5d58c0617ad372a964d91aea26d0:0
- value
- 2429313
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ae7082c6370d0a7bd404cc258d9142bc8e265f0
- address
- bc1qttnsstrrwrg2002qfnp93kg590ywye0ssj7nn4